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Gamma
- Free plan limited to 400 non-renewable credits, requiring paid plan quickly
- Credit rollover capped at 2x monthly allocation, forcing month-to-month spending
- Refund window limited to 3 days with usage thresholds restricting claims
- Per-seat pricing on team plans increases costs for large organizations
- Studio Mode limited to Ultra plan, restricting advanced editing to highest tier
Reflect
- No free tier or free plan option
- Losing your password means permanent data loss with no recovery option
- Shared notes are not end-to-end encrypted despite platform marketing encryption
- AI features send your content to OpenAI servers (30-day retention)
- Mobile apps have limited offline functionality compared to desktop

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Gamma: How do Gamma AI credits work?
Each plan includes a monthly AI credit allowance. Free users receive 400 one-time credits. Plus plan includes 1,000 monthly credits, Pro includes 4,000 monthly credits, and Ultra includes 20,000 monthly credits. Unused credits roll over up to 2x the monthly allowance.
SourceReflect: Is there a free tier?
No. Reflect offers only a 14-day free trial before requiring $10/month (billed annually). There is no free plan.
SourceGamma: What is included in the Free plan?
The Free plan includes 400 AI credits (one-time), up to 10 cards per prompt, basic AI, Gamma branding on output, and 7-day change history.
SourceReflect: Does Reflect work offline?
Yes, editing and note-taking work offline on desktop. Mobile apps have offline limitations compared to the desktop experience.
SourceGamma: What payment and refund options does Gamma offer?
Gamma offers a 3-day refund window for monthly plans if you have used less than 10-20 percent of your monthly credits depending on the plan.
SourceReflect: How secure is my data?
Reflect uses end-to-end encryption with XChaCha20-Poly1305. An independent audit by Doyensec found no vulnerabilities. However, audio for transcription and text sent to AI features are processed by OpenAI servers (retained 30 days per OpenAI policy).
SourceGamma: How much do Team and Business plans cost?
Team plans cost $20 per seat per month with a minimum of 2 seats, including 6,000 AI credits per seat. Business plans cost $40 per seat per month with a minimum of 10 seats, including 10,000 AI credits per seat.
